GiMeSpace TouchSpace Synth is described as 'This program was created to make playing music on a computer more intuitive and affordable for anyone who wants to make music. It offers the most natural way to make music by simply using your touch screen or your hand in front of the web cam' and is a music production app in the audio & music category. There are more than 25 alternatives to GiMeSpace TouchSpace Synth for a variety of platforms, including Windows, Linux, Mac, BSD and iPad apps. The best GiMeSpace TouchSpace Synth alternative is Vital, which is both free and Open Source. Other great apps like GiMeSpace TouchSpace Synth are Helm, ZynAddSubFX, Dexed and yoshimi.

    Vital is a spectral warping wavetable synthesizer with drag'n'drop modulation workflow and animated preview of the synth's inner workings where needed. Comes with many modulation sources (including audio-rate), MPE support and FX chain.

    Helm is a free, cross-platform, polyphonic synthesizer with a powerful modulation system. Helm runs on GNU/Linux, Mac, and Windows as a standalone program or LV2/VST/VST3/AU plugin.

    Dexed is an FM-type softsynth developed by Pascal Gauthier of Digital Suburban. It is an ideal application for importing, playing and editing/managing sysex patches from both the classic Yamaha DX7 synthesizer and the TX7.

    Yoshimi is a software synthesizer for Linux based on the 2.4.0 release of ZynAddSubFX, written by Nasca Octavian Paul. Yoshimi delivers the same synth capabilities, along with very good Jack and Alsa midi/audio functionality.

    WhySynth is a versatile softsynth which operates as a plugin for the DSSI Soft Synth Interface. A brief list of features:

    • 4 oscillators, 2 filters, 3 LFOs, and 5 envelope generators per voice.

    • 10 oscillator modes: minBLEP, wavecycle, asynchronous granular, three FM.

    Tyrell is the name of a project by the German online magazine Amazona.de. A reader survey and follow-on forum posts provided a pool of ideas for a low cost HARDWARE analogue synth, which Mic 'Moogulator' Irmer used to develop quite a powerful concept.

  12. TAL-NoiseMaker is an improved version of TAL-Elek7ro and has a completely new synth engine and a lot of improvements in sound and usability. The synth also includes a small effect section with a reverb, chorus and a simple bit crusher effect.
